#63db1f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63db1f is composed of 38.8% red, 85.9%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 98.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 49%. #63db1f color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ff3e with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#63db1f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63db1f has RGB values of R:99, G:219,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 6544159.

Shades and Tints of #63db1f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#63db1f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8476 is the less saturated color, while #5bf802 is the most saturated one.
